Product parameters:
1. Brand: eletechsup
2. Model: IO34H02
3. Load capacity: 10A 120VAC 5A 220VAC
4. Working power consumption: 42mA
5. Output voltage: AC 110-220V
6. Power supply voltage: AC 110-220V
7. Weight with shell: 27 grams
8. Dimensions with shell: 44×40×21mm
9. Unified length of wires: 50mm
10. Maximum standby power consumption: 12mA
11. Number of control channels: 1 output
12. Working temperature: -25℃~85℃
13. Working humidity: 5%~95%RH
14. Shell: PC flame retardant material
15. Function: Stop power supply after a delay,Delay Time 1-480Min Adjustable
16.Control power: incandescent lamp 1000W (maximum), energy-saving lamp 300W (maximum)
17. With LED indicator light to show the working status (steady on means working, flashing means the end of delay)
18. Applicable scenarios: living room, kitchen, bathroom, bedroom, corridor, stairs, etc.
19. Wide range of uses: such as exhaust fans, motors, air coolers, cooling fans, germicidal lamps, humidifiers, heaters, etc.
20. 16 delay modes can be selected (1 minute, 3 minutes, 5 minutes, 10 minutes, 15 minutes, 25 minutes, 30 minutes, 40 minutes, 50 minutes, 60 minutes, 90 minutes, 120 minutes, 180 minutes, 240 minutes , 300 minutes, 480 minutes)
Module function: This module is a delayed power-off module. When the set delay time expires, stop power supply.
Working status: After the power is turned on, the indicator (PWR) will remain on; after the delay is over, the indicator (PWR) will continue to flash.
How to use:
①: Set the time you need to delay (no live settings are allowed);
②: After checking that the wiring is OK, power on, the module starts to work after power on, (the indicator light is always on), and the module stops power supply when the time is up (indication light flashes).
1. If it needs to be turned off in advance during use, directly disconnect the main power supply of the module.
2. Start the second delay: re-power on.
Delay time selection method:
①: Refer to the delay mode table to select the time to be delayed;
②: Toggle the DIP switch (red) according to the delay mode table;
③: After setting, check the wiring and then power on.
Note:When a new delay mode needs to be set, in order to ensure personal safety, it must be set in a power-off mode, and live operation is prohibited. |
